Travel RN Opportunity – MedSurg Unit, Henderson, North Carolina

Position Details

  • Specialty: Registered Nurse (RN) – MedSurg
  • Employment Type: Travel
  • Shift: Nights (7 PM – 7 AM)
  • Weekly Hours: 36 guaranteed
  • Weekend Hours: Every other weekend
  • Call Requirements: None specified
  • Contract Length: 13 weeks

Facility & Unit Information

  • Unit: MedSurg
  • Number of Beds: 48
  • Patient Ratio: 1:6
  • Patient Population: Adult (no pediatrics)
  • Electronic Health Record: Paragon
  • Trauma Level: Not specified

Requirements & Preferences

  • Certifications Required: BLS (Basic Life Support)
  • Preferred Certifications: ACLS (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support)
  • Licenses: Registered Nurse License (North Carolina)
  • Education: ADN accepted; BSN preferred
  • Experience: Not explicitly specified
  • Float Requirements: Rare
  • Personality Fit: Team player; punctual and reliable attendance required
  • Additional Notes: Holiday rotation required

Dress Code

  • Scrub Colors: Blue or Black
  • Unacceptable Attire: No casual wear

About Henderson, NC

As a Travel Medical Surgical Nurse in Henderson, NC here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Henderson's cost of living is l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• In the summer, average highs are around 89°F, and in the winter, average lows are around 27°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short-term rentals are available and relatively easy to find in Henderson.
Transportation
  • Henderson is car-friendly, with most residents relying on private vehicles for transportation.
  • Public transportation options are limited.
Demographics
  • Henderson has a diverse population with a wide age range.
  • Common health issues may include obesity and heart disease.
  • There is a small but growing population of travel nurses in the area.
Things to Do
  • Henderson offers a variety of restaurants serving Southern cuisine, as well as opportunities to explore art and music.
  •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y nearby parks and recreational activities.
